About

To run this action-packed indie game smoothly, an entry-level GPU like the GTX 1650 or RX 6500 XT is sufficient. With these graphics cards, players can expect decent performance at 1080p resolution with medium settings. The game's visual demands are relatively light, making it accessible even for those on a budget or using older hardware.

For those with a more powerful setup, such as a GTX 1660 Super or RTX 2060, targeting higher settings at 1080p or even 1440p is feasible. This will enhance the visual experience while maintaining good frame rates. Overall, the title is designed to be approachable for a wide range of systems, making it a great choice for casual gamers and those looking to enjoy multiplayer modes without needing top-tier hardware.
